Electronic Poker Schemes


Much like vingt-et-un, cards are chosen from a finite amount of cards. Accordingly you can use a guide to log cards given out. Knowing which cards already dealt provides you insight of cards left to be given out. Be sure to understand how many decks the machine you pick relies on in order to make accurate decisions.

The hands you bet on in a game of poker in a table game may not be the same hands you are seeking to play on an electronic poker machine. To pump up your bankroll, you should go after the most potent hands far more regularly, despite the fact that it means bypassing a few small hands. In the long haul these sacrifices most likely will pay for themselves.

Video Poker has in common some tactics with video slots too. For one, you make sure to gamble the maximum coins on each hand. When you at last do win the big prize it will profit. Getting the jackpot with just half the max wager is certainly to defeat. If you are wagering on at a dollar game and can’t manage to pay the maximum, drop down to a 25 cent machine and bet with maximum coins there. On a dollar game $.75 isn’t the same thing as seventy five cents on a 25 cent machine.

Also, like slot machines, electronic Poker is on all accounts arbitrary. Cards and new cards are allotted numbers. While the computer is idle it goes through these numbers several thousand per second, when you press deal or draw the machine pauses on a number and deals out the card assigned to that number. This dispels the fairy tale that an electronic poker machine might become ‘ready’ to get a cash prize or that immediately before getting a big hand it could become cold. Each hand is just as likely as every other to profit.
